The cotton gin was a great invention for food production.
a. True
b. False

2 Answers

4 votes

Answer:

False. It was used to separate cotton seeds from cotton to produce more cotton for sale. It was invented by Eli Whitney in 1793 and created a major boost in the production of cotton as many farmers grew rich but it also spread the system of slavery in the Southern states.
